On Forbes Newsroom, Emerson College Polling senior director Matt Taglia discussed a new Emerson College poll of the California Governor and Los Angeles mayoral races. Taglia described the findings as showing “the rise of Xavier Becerra” in the contest, indicating that the former California Attorney General and U.S. Secretary of Health and Human Services is gaining traction among voters.
The poll, conducted in recent weeks, suggests a dynamic shift in the race as candidates jockey for position ahead of the primary and general election later this year. While specific numerical results were not disclosed in the segment, Taglia emphasized that Becerra’s improved standing reflects a broader trend in voter sentiment, with key issues such as housing affordability, homelessness, and healthcare access driving support.
Becerra, who served in the Biden administration, brings a strong progressive track record on healthcare and consumer protection, which could resonate with California’s Democratic electorate. The race remains fluid, with multiple candidates competing for the nomination, and the poll results could influence campaign strategies in the coming months.

Key Highlights
- Becerra’s Rising Profile: The poll marks a notable uptick in name recognition and voter support for Becerra, who has been relatively less prominent in early polling compared to other contenders like Gavin Newsom (if running again) or other state officials. However, with Newsom term-limited, the race is wide open.
- Policy Implications: Becerra’s background as HHS Secretary and California Attorney General suggests a potential emphasis on healthcare expansion, drug pricing regulation, and environmental enforcement. For businesses operating in California, this could mean tighter oversight in sectors such as pharmaceuticals, health insurers, and energy.
- Investor Sentiment: Political uncertainty often weighs on markets, and a Becerra candidacy — with his record of aggressive legal actions against major corporations — may prompt investors to reassess exposure to California-based companies, particularly in tech, healthcare, and agriculture.
- Voter Priorities: The poll signals that economic issues like housing costs and inflation remain top of mind for Californians. Candidates who can address these concerns while balancing progressive reforms may gain an edge.
- Los Angeles Mayoral Race: The same poll also covered the Los Angeles mayoral election, though details were not expanded upon in the segment. Mayor races in major cities can set the tone for urban policy trends that affect real estate and local business climates.

Expert Insights
The California governor’s race comes at a critical juncture for the state, which remains the world’s fifth-largest economy. A Becerra victory could reshape the regulatory environment significantly given his history of challenging corporate practices. As the former attorney general, he sued the Trump administration more than 100 times and took on major pharmaceutical companies over drug prices. Such a stance might receive broad support from progressive voters but could create headwinds for certain industries.
From an investment perspective, political shifts in California carry national implications due to the state’s influence on technology, entertainment, and agriculture. Investors may monitor policy proposals on housing supply, carbon emissions, and healthcare costs that emerge from candidate platforms. A candidate like Becerra, with deep ties to Washington D.C. and the Democratic establishment, might also signal closer alignment with federal policy directions, affecting sectors reliant on state-federal cooperation.
However, the race is still early, and voter preferences can change rapidly. The Emerson poll provides a snapshot, but upcoming debates, endorsements, and campaign developments could alter the trajectory. Market participants should remain attentive to how the contest evolves, as California’s next governor will wield significant power over taxation, regulation, and infrastructure spending that directly affects business operations and economic growth within the state and beyond.
